The Matrox MURA IPX 4K capture and IP encode/decode cards feature four HDMI, four SDI, or two DisplayPort inputs for high-resolution capture, encoding, streaming, recording and decoding of up to four 4K or 16 HD streams—delivering an unmatched audiovisual experience.\nThese PCI Express cards can stream and record an entire video wall or selected regions of interest, with pixel for pixel or scaled down representation of the display wall anywhere on the network. Mura IPX 4K capture and IP encode/decode can easily satisfy system builder requirements through the mixing and matching of a wide selection of Matrox video wall components. Ideal for control rooms, digital signage, AV presentation, security, and other applications that involve high-density capture, encoding, streaming, recording, decoding, and control operations.\nHigh-Density H.264 Encoding and Decoding\nMura IPX cards have been engineered to offer world-class, high-density H.264 encoding and decoding capabilities for use in virtually any application of encoding, decoding, or transcoding.\nResolution\nResolution encoding and decoding including the streaming, and recording of a single 8K* stream or multiple 4K, Full HD, or SD streams.\nQuality\nQuality encoding and decoding through the encoding support of desktop-grade, high-frequency content. Mura IPX allows for perfect desktop sharing and recording applications on content as detailed as only one pixel thick.\nNumber of streams\nNumber of streams encoding and decoding for numerous applications ranging from decode and display of a high number of streaming IP sources, to the capture and streaming of multiple independent streams of video content at multiple bitrates, resolutions, and quality levels.\nAll-in-One H.264 Supernode\nMura IPX provides the capability to capture, stream, encode, and decode using H.264 all from with one PCIe card. Mura IPX series cards are designed to gather and distribute video from multiple IP sources and direct inputs, allowing the aggregation, recording, and delivery of compelling and complementary content as needed to Mura IPX-enabled workstations and compatible receiving hardware and software.\nEncoding/Decoding Support for H.264 Universal Standard\nMura IPX supports high-density H.264 level 5.2 encoding and decoding, and thrives on the massive interactivity this produces with 3rd-party hardware and software products. Collectively accepted on the vast majority of network infrastructures, the H.264 codec allows for efficient encoding and decoding at low bitrates and high quality (from SD to 8K) based on user needs.\nRemote Video Wall\nCan stream and record an entire video wall or selected regions of interest, with pixel for pixel or scaled down representation of the display wall anywhere on the network.\nDynamic System Scalability\nThrough the integration of the low-footprint Mura IPX cards, video wall controllers, multiviewers, and personal video walls can be built to the scale required for specific projects. Optimized for performance, Mura IPX provides options to allow greater flexibility in integration while also offering enhanced thermal reliability.\nMulti-Source HDMI, DisplayPort, or SDI Inputs for Video Capture\nWith four Mini HDMI, four SDI, or two DisplayPort inputs, Mura IPX can capture a wide variety of inputs, dependent on the number of sources and the display resolution required.\nDirect Memory Access\nMura IPX series capture cards provide the ability to directly access system or graphics memory for a given application to obtain the raw data and perform a variety of processing operations —including analysis, warping, and rendering, among others.\nEnhance Deployed Matrox Products by Adding Mura IPX\nMatrox Mura IPX Series paired with Matrox Mura MPX\n- Up to 56 synchronized output\n- Single-slot input/output cards allow high density, flexibility, and scalability\nMatrox Mura IPX Series paired with Matrox C-Series\n- Up to 18 synchronized output\n- High-resolution monitor support, including Full HD and 4K/UHD\n\nAdvanced Video Processing\nOptimized to provide robust video processing functions, such as crop, rotation, flip, mirror, alpha blend, and color key, Mura IPX provides a canvas and comprehensive video toolset for smoother post-production effects. Through this functionality, inputs can be adjusted to suit the exact output needs of both in-person users and the remote audience.\nIP Connectivity\nBy enabling communication across devices over the LAN through a network jack, Matrox has extended the ability of video walls from a group of stationary displays to a networked hub of interconnected monitors. Not only can Mura IPX receive and decode IP streams, but it can stream encoded video, receivable on other Mura IPX-enabled devices and third party hardware and software.\nAdjustable Color Depth & Pixel Transfer Formats\nOffering the user the flexibility to control the level of color detail required, Mura IPX allows RGB 8:8:8 & RGB 10:10:10, as well as 8-bit and 10-bit per component YUV color. As such, Mura IPX delivers deep 32-bit color, as well as 24-bit true color based on your needs.\nDepending on the scenario, it may be advisable to subsample color to save bandwidth. Offering full 4:4:4 color to preserve full-color depth, Mura IPX also permits 4:2:2 and 4:2:0 subsampling to reduce bandwidth load where users will not be affected by the reduction in color detail.
